The Hot Zone is a 1995 nonfiction book by Richard Preston describing the events that unfolded in Reston, Virginia when the lethal filovirus Ebola was apparently accidentally imported with monkeys from the Philippines. It is not a book for the squeamish; there are extremely graphic descriptions of how exactly Marburg and Ebola ravage the human body.
